So, after a bit of playing about, I came to the conclusion that the layout still isn't quite right. I have to duck under the station board to get to the TMD board, which, while I'm still young, I'm not getting any younger to keep ducking. The station itself is too big and doesn't work for me either, with a lot of my stock being freight but little emphasis to play with the freight wagons.
Also, one of the corners is too tight for my liking to the north of the station, so the solution? Yep, starting it again!
The layout will now have a much smaller station in one corner, with 2 through platforms and 2 bay platforms. I've lowered a baseboard near the station to have an embankment scene. The TMD will still be in the same place it is now, but, it's enterance will be from the opposite side and have better sheds. The McDonalds scene from the last page is staying exactly where it is.
Lastly, a container terminal will sit where the current station is now. The main line will loop around the back of the container terminal, with a 'branch' going to a hidden fiddle yard at the top of the layout.
I'm doing this to have shallower corners for the stock and reduce de-railments and better track joins, and to have more emphasis on shunting rather than a large multi platform station. Modern day passenger stock is quite 'boring' in terms of operation and variety, so putting the focus on freight with its multitude of wagons makes sense for me now.
